Syntax-semantics interface in linguistic literature have been dealt with in two opposite mainstreams; a syntacticallyoriented perspective (Chomsky 1957, 65, 79, 81, Horrock 1987, and Haegman 1992) modified and supported later on by the Optimality Theory approach of Alan Prince and Paul Smolensky (1993) and a semantically-oriented one in its two facets the generative and the interpretive (Jerrold J. Katz Jerry A. Fodor: 1963, George Lakoff 1963 and Fillmore 1968). Furthermore, some experimental psycholinguistic and neurolinguistic studies have been presented to support or reject one or both of these perspectives (Millar Mckean 1964, Gleason, J. Ratner, N. 1993, Friederici, Angela D., Jiirgen Weissenborn 2007). This paper is at attempt to shed some light on this serious linguistic controversy to arrive at some general outlines that might be of help to the linguistic theorists, language second/foreign teachers and students to establish a scientific scheme in dealing with language
